In the analytical technique of mass spectrometry, atoms or molecules are ionized using a high-energy electron beam and then separated based on their mass-to-charge ratios (m/z). The results are presented as a mass spectrum, which shows the relative abundances of the ions on the y-axis and their m/z ratios on the x-axis.

As mass spectrometers can only … WebMass Spec of Compounds Mass specs can also be used to measure the RMM of a compound. The compound will be the sample in this case. It enters the machine and gets ionized, deflected and detected. The ion with the greatest mass to charge ratio (m/z) is the so called parent ion. The mass of this ion is considered to be the RMM of the compound.
